               The GAME Group plc: Appointment of Chief Executive 
 
GAME Group plc ("GAME") today announces the appointment of Ian Shepherd (41) as 
Chief Executive Officer ("CEO") with effect from 28 June 2010. Chris Bell, who 
has performed the role of Interim CEO since 21st April 2010 pending the 
appointment of a new CEO, will then resume his role as the Group's senior non 
executive director. 
 
Ian is an expert in the management and development of customer relationships, 
with 16 years' experience in consumer technology and entertainment brands. He 
spent the past four years at Vodafone plc, latterly as its UK Consumer Director, 
leading the company's largest division with over GBP3bn in revenue. His 
responsibilities included the Vodafone UK retail chain with 400 stores, and 
2,000 staff, the product and brand marketing teams, as well as online sales and 
the specialist mobile internet team. 
 
Before joining Vodafone, Ian spent nine years at BSkyB, including five as 
Customer Marketing Director and two as Managing Director of Sky Interactive. He 
launched a succession of new products including new games, interactive services, 
technology platforms and websites, and oversaw Sky's customer base management 
during a period in which it delivered exceptionally low customer churn.

Notes to Editors 
 
 
Biographical details for Ian Shepherd: 
 
Ian Shepherd (41) has spent two decades studying and understanding consumers, in 
particular people and families who are bringing new technology into their lives. 
 
After graduating with an Economics degree from Cambridge in 1990, Ian joined the 
LEK partnership, a UK based management consultancy. He then joined Cable & 
Wireless where he held a variety of commercial roles. 
 
In 1997 Ian joined BSkyB, initially as Distribution Strategy Director, then 
Customer Marketing Director, and finally Managing Director of Sky Interactive, 
the world's largest interactive television business. During his nine years at 
Sky he launched a succession of new products including new games, interactive 
services, technology platforms and websites, and was responsible for managing 
the business's customer base, delivering historically low churn rates through an 
award winning customer marketing programme. 
 
Ian spent the past four years at Vodafone plc, latterly as its UK Consumer 
Director. He sat on the Board of the UK subsidiary and led the consumer 
division, the largest part of the business with over GBP3bn in revenue. His 
responsibilities included the Vodafone UK retail chain with 400 stores and 2000 
staff, and the product and brand marketing teams as well as online sales and the 
specialist mobile internet team.  He has also held a number of other senior 
positions at the company including roles as Director of Commercial Operations, 
and Strategy and Business Development Director. 
 
Ian is married with one son and one daughter. He has been a keen gamer for over 
30 years, from the earliest home computers through to his current obsession with 
Modern Warfare 2. He is also in the process of completing his pilot's licence.
